Meaning of normalhood | Babel Free

Noun CEFR B2

Definitions

The state or condition of being normal; normality, normalcy.

uncountable

Examples

“Just as getting rid of my marital bed had marked another step forward in my journey to Normalhood, the new bed had lured da Vinci to my side like bait: […]”
““No offense to your former status, but being seen with Supergeek won't exactly catapult me into the normalhood I seek.””
“It's a spiritual path toward normalhood for chudails. That's what Tantric-ji preaches.”
“In world full of gay drones on their merry way to normalhood, a gay flamboyant savior emerged to make us laugh and shriek with delight.”
